Why Advertising Pays More

Higher budgets

A 30-second TV commercial can cost 500,000-2,000,000+ MAD to produce. More budget = better pay for everyone.

Brand stakes

The client's brand image depends on every detail, including extras looking exactly right for the message.

Image rights

Your face may appear on TV, billboards, social media — all compensable beyond the daily rate.

Short duration

1-2 days max for a commercial, so per-day rates are naturally higher to attract talent.

Pay rates

Pay Rates by Commercial Type

TypeBackground (MAD/day)Featured (MAD/day)Principal (MAD/day)
Local brand TV300-600500-1,2001,000-3,000
National brand400-800800-2,0002,000-6,000
Multinational brand500-1,2001,000-3,0003,000-10,000
Digital/social media300-500500-1,000800-2,500
Print (magazine/billboard)400-800800-2,0001,500-5,000
Image rights

Understanding Image Rights Multipliers

Image rights are where the real money is. When your face is clearly identifiable in the final ad, you're compensated based on three multipliers:

FactorScopeMultiplier
MediaTV only1x base
TV + digital1.5x
TV + digital + print + billboard2-3x
TerritoryMorocco only1x base
North Africa1.5x
Africa2x
Worldwide3-5x
Duration3 months1x base
6 months1.5x
12 months2x
Unlimited3-4x
Real example calculation

You're a featured extra in a multinational TV + digital ad for Morocco + Africa for 12 months.

Base rate: 2,000 MAD

Image rights: 2,000 × 1.5 (media) × 2 (territory) × 2 (duration) = 12,000 MAD for image rights alone

Total: 14,000 MAD for one day of work.
